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
КИТ-1 / MS Project.doc
Скачиваний:
106
Добавлен:
20.02.2016
Размер:
1.99 Mб
Скачать

Анализ и оптимизация плана проекта

После того как стоимость всех ресурсов определена, завершено формирование проектного треугольника. Однако создание рабочего проекта на этом не закончилось: прежде чем начинать исполнение работ по плану, нужно проверить, что все стороны треугольника сбалансированы и соответствуют нашим ожиданиям.

План нужно проанализировать в нескольких аспектах. Во-первых, необходимо убедиться в соответствии расписания потребностям: ведь в процессе определения назначений длительности задач могли измениться. Во-вторых, необходимо проверить соответствие загрузки ресурсов: в процессе выделения ресурсов мы могли перегрузить некоторых из них. В-третьих, нужно проверить соответствие общей стоимости проекта, определившейся после создания назначений, нашим ожиданиям: в процессе назначения ресурсов мы могли назначить на задачи слишком много дорогостоящих ресурсов и тем самым превысить ожидаемую стоимость. И наконец, нужно оценить риски выполнения проекта: насколько велика вероятность не уложиться в расписание, не выполнить все поставленные задачи и не уложиться в бюджет. Если в процессе анализа обнаруживаются проблемы, необходимо избавляться от них, оптимизируя план соответствующим образом.

Анализ и выравнивание загрузки ресурсов

Чтобы определить равномерность загрузки ресурсов, нужно открыть представление Resource Sheet (Лист ресурсов). В нем все ресурсы, загрузка которых превышает их доступность, выделены красным цветом, а в колонке Indicators (Индикаторы) рядом с их названиями отображается специальный значок (рис. 26).

Превышение доступности ресурса заключается в том, что для выполнения назначенной работы ресурсу требуется больше времени, чем у него есть. Существует несколько причин, способных привести к этому. Самой распространенной среди них является назначение ресурса на задачи, исполнение которых полностью или частично осуществляется одновременно. Другим вариантом может быть увеличение объема работ задачи, приведшее к превышению допустимого уровня загрузки ресурса. Наконец, назначение ресурса из-за изменений в плане может приходиться на дни, когда ресурс недоступен.

Рис. 26. Названия ресурсов с превышением загрузки выделены цветом

Выровнять загрузку ресурсов можно несколькими способами. Во-первых, уменьшив объем работы перегруженных ресурсов, сократив некоторые задачи или назначив других сотрудников на их выполнение. Во-вторых, избавившись от пересечения задач, вставив в расписание перерывы в задачах или назначениях либо изменив даты их начала и окончания. Наконец, учтя работу, выполняемую ресурсом сверх нормы, как сверхурочную.

Для выравнивания загрузки ресурсов в Microsoft Project можно воспользоваться автоматизированными средствами, а можно перераспределить загрузку вручную. Как правило, используются оба способа, поскольку команда автоматизированного выравнивания использует только второй из перечисленных методов выравнивания и поэтому обычно не может выровнять загрузку всех ресурсов.

Автоматическое выравнивание загрузки ресурсов

Диалоговое окно выравнивания загрузки ресурсов открывается с помощью команды меню Tools > Level Resources (Сервис > Выравнивание загрузки ресурсов). В разделе Leveling calculations (Вычисления для выравнивания) определяются общие параметры выравнивания загрузки (рис. 27). Переключатели Automatic (Выполнять автоматически) и Manual (Выполнять вручную) определяют, как будет осуществляться выравнивание: непосредственно при создании назначений (первый вариант) или при нажатии кнопки Level Now (Выровнять) в этом диалоговом окне (второй).

Рис. 27. Диалоговое окно выравнивания загрузки ресурсов

Раскрывающийся список Look for overallocations (Поиск превышений доступности) определяет величину временного блока, в рамках которого программа будет искать превышение доступности. Например, если сотрудник назначен на две 4-часовые задачи, начинающиеся в 8 утра, то при поиске превышения доступности по часам (пункт списка Hour by Hour (По часам)) одна из задач будет отложена на 4 часа, чтобы ни в одном из часов дня не было превышения доступности. Если же в списке выбран пункт Day by Day (По дням), то расписание не изменится, поскольку в пределах дня объем работы не превышает нормы.

При установленном флажке Clear leveling values before leveling (Очистка данных предыдущего выравнивания перед новым выравниванием) перед новым выравниванием.

Ручное выравнивание ресурсов

Ручное выравнивание ресурсов осуществляется в два этапа. Сначала нужно найти те задачи, назначение на которые перегружает ресурсы. Затем нужно определить, как избавиться от перегрузки, поскольку вариантов довольно много. Можно перенести задачу, прервать ее или изменить ее длительность. Можно уменьшить объем работы для ресурса или удалить назначение, причем как выделив на задачу другого сотрудника взамен перегруженного, так и не сделав этого. В таком случае трудозатраты задачи уменьшатся. Наконец, можно сохранить перегрузку, перенеся избыточные трудозатраты ресурса в сверхурочные.

Согласование плана проекта

Готовый и проанализированный план проекта обычно нужно согласовывать с руководством организации или заказчиком. Для этого план нужно подготовить к передаче, распространить на согласование и затем внести в него необходимые изменения.

Готовый план проекта нужно распространить для утверждения. Есть несколько способов это сделать: можно разослать файл в формате .mрр о электронной почте, включить фрагменты данных из файла проекта в другие документы офисных форматов, полностью конвертировать файл в другой формат и, наконец, можно распространить файл в распечатанном виде.

Рассылка плана по электронной почте

Чтобы отослать план по электронной почте, нужно выбрать команду меню File> Send To > Mail Recipient (as Attachment) (Файл > Отправить > Сообщение (как вложение)). В результате создается сообщение, к которому прикреплен файл проекта, и от вас потребуется лишь выбрать адресатов письма и отправить его.

Отправка по маршруту

При согласовании плана часто требуется утвердить его у нескольких руководителей, причем обычно они утверждают его по очереди в соответствии с установленным в организации порядком. Например, сначала план должен утвердить начальник отдела, затем главный бухгалтер, после него — руководитель проектного офиса и, наконец, директор по производству.

Для автоматизации пересылки файла в определенной очередности можно создать маршрут, по которому файл будет автоматически перенаправляться от одного руководителя к другому. Для этого предназначено диалоговое окно настройки маршрута открываемое с помощью команды меню File > Send To > Routing Recipient (Файл > Отправить > По маршруту).

После того как вы настроите параметры отправки файла по маршруту, вместо этой команды в меню появится команда Other Routing Recipient (Другой адресат).

Публикация на сервере Microsoft Exchange

Если в организации используется сервер Microsoft Exchange и компьютер подключен к нему, то в подменю File > Send To (Файл > Отправить) будет доступна команда Exchange Folder (Папка Exchange). При щелчке на этой команде откроется диалоговое окно со списком папок, в которые вы можете поместить файл. Для сохранения файла в общей папке у вас должны быть соответствующие разрешения, полученные от администратора системы.

Экспорт плана в файлы других форматов

MS Project содержит удобные команды для экспорта данных в другие форматы, среди которых есть как форматы документов семейства Microsoft Office (Excel и Access), так и межплатформенные (HTML и XML). Начнем обучение экспорту данных из MS Project именно с универсальных форматов.

Экспорт данных в HTML

Экспорт данных в HTML используется очень часто для публикации информации о проекте на веб-странице. Именно поэтому для сохранения файла в этом формате предназначена отдельная команда Save As Web Page (Сохранить как вебстраницу) в меню File (Файл).

XML

Для экспорта проектных данных в XML достаточно выбрать этот формат в диалоговом окне, вызываемом командой меню File > Save As (Файл > Сохранить как). Программа сохранит в этом формате всю проектную информацию, включая как план проекта, так и значения всех параметров, список календарей, настраиваемых полей и пр. — одним словом, файл проекта целиком. Правда, следует иметь в виду, что файлы получаются большими (например, XML-файл с данными нашего небольшого проекта занимает около 700 Кбайт).

Microsoft Excel

Чтобы начать экспорт плана проекта в Microsoft Excel, в диалоговом окне File > Save As (Файл > Сохранить как) нужно выбрать для сохранения файла формат *.xls. MS Project может сохранить данные в одном из двух форматов — в формате рабочей книги (Workbook) Excel или сводной таблицы (PivotTable), и мастер экспорта данных будет действовать в зависимости от выбора формата.

Базы данных

MS Project позволяет экспортировать данные в любую базу данных, имеющую интерфейс ODBC. Для этого нужно средствами Windows создать подключение к этой базе данных через ODBC и затем в диалоговом окне File > Save As (Файл > Сохранить как) нажать кнопку ODBC и выбрать созданное подключение в списке.

Текстовые форматы

MS Project позволяет экспортировать данные в текстовые форматы (txt, csv). Чтобы экспортировать план проекта в один их этих форматов, нужно выбрать в списке типов файлов диалогового окна, вызываемого командой меню File > Save As (Файл > Сохранить как), пункт Text (Текст) или CSV. После этого запускается мастер экспорта.

Анализ рисков

Анализ опасностей, которые могут возникнуть при выполнении составленного плана, — один из самых интересных и сложных этапов планирования проекта. От того, как проведен анализ, зависит, будет ли проект успешно завершен. В этом уроке вы научитесь определять риски с помощью MS Project, описывать их и разрабатывать стратегии их смягчения. Для проведения анализа мы задействуем все имеющиеся в нашем арсенале средства: настраиваемые поля, формулы, стандартные и настраиваемые фильтры, сортировки. Но и это не все — в конце урока мы освоим средства анализа проектных данных в Microsoft Excel и с их помощью проведем исследование нашего проекта.

План составлен, проект укладывается в сроки, бюджет соответствует ожиданиям и загрузка ресурсов не превышает их доступность. Самое время задуматься: а удастся ли выполнить этот план, если, например, заболеет сотрудник с уникальными навыками, которого никто не может заменить, или авторы не сдадут статьи в срок, или в типографию вовремя не привезут краску, или произойдет еще что-нибудь непредвиденное? Ответы на эти вопросы можно получить, анализируя риски проекта.

Анализ рисков состоит из нескольких этапов. Сначала нужно определить возможные риски. Затем для каждого из них нужно определить стратегию смягчения влияния риска на проект, то есть действия, предпринимаемые для предотвращения риска или в случае осуществления риска для того, чтобы проект был успешно завершен.

Определение рисков

Часто в процессе определения рисков невозможно детально проанализировать весь план проекта в разумное время (например, если план состоит из нескольких сотен задач). В таких случаях в первую очередь нужно анализировать риски у задач, которые находятся на критическом пути проекта или могут стать критическими. Чтобы определить, какие задачи могут стать критическими, можно воспользоваться оптимистической и пессимистической диаграммами Ганта, полученными в результате анализа методом PERT.

При определении рисков информацию нужно заносить в план проекта. Для этого нужно подготовить настраиваемые поля Мы переименовали поле для задач Text2 (Текст2) в Описание риска, а поле для задач Texts (ТекстЗ) — в Вероятность осуществления риска, причем для последнего мы создали список значений: Высокая, Средняя и Низкая, что позволит быстро заполнять это поле. Кроме того, на основании таблицы Entry (Ввод) для задач мы создали таблицу Ввод информации о рисках и оставили в ней лишь необходимый набор полей. И наконец, на базе таблицы мы создали два представления: Риски, в котором эта таблица находится рядом с диаграммой Ганта, и комбинированное представление Риски2, в верхней части которого находится представление Риски, а в нижней — Task Form (Форма задач). Теперь можно переходить к определению рисков.

Риски определяются для трех аспектов проекта: расписания, ресурсов и бюджета. Так выявляются события, осуществление которых может помешать завершить проект в срок или создать нехватку ресурсов или денег в определенный момент его выполнения. Если при определении риска становится ясно, как уменьшить его, то нужно сразу же вносить соответствующие изменения в план проекта.

Разработка стратегии смягчения рисков

После того как мы выявили проектные риски, нужно определить меры, смягчающие их влияние на проект. Это можно сделать двумя путями: разработать план их сдерживания или план реакции на них.

План сдерживания рисков (mitigation plan) состоит из работ, которые включаются в план проекта и, будучи выполненными, существенно снижают вероятность осуществления риска. План реакции на риски (contingency plan) определяется в плане проекта, но не оформляется в виде задач до осуществления риска. Если риск осуществляется, нужные задачи добавляются в план проекта.

Определяя стратегию смягчения рисков, следует всегда сравнивать затраты на предотвращение риска с затратами, которые будут понесены, если риск осуществится. Например, если в случае осуществления риска бюджет возрастет на $100, то стоимость работ по сдерживанию не должна превышать этой цифры. Когда важнее сроки проекта, следует сравнивать длительность плана в случае осуществления риска с длительностью плана, учитывающей задачи на его смягчение